QUOTE(zidane88 @ Jun 30 2008, 09:39 PM)
It seems that Telstra( australia telco ) has announced the pricing the iphone...
source : click here
*
The Next G iPhone 3G plans start at AU$30 per month with an upfront cost of AU$279 for the 8GB model and AU$399 for the 16GB model, although the 8GB model is free on AU$80 plans and the 16GB model is free on AU$100 plans. All plans require a 24-month contract.

Telstra only offers post paid plan, I am waiting for Vodafone and Optus to announce their pricing as they offer prepaid and postpaid plan. Most of the customers would like to have prepaid so let's hope Voda and Optus will offer a better pricing. wink.gif
